一种基于动态阈值的镀铜表面缺陷检测算法

摘    要:表面缺陷检测是机器视觉检测领域的一个主要问题,针对版滚镀铜表面缺陷的特点,提出一种动态阈值缺陷检测算法。该算法采用整体结合局部的灰度特征方法、利用缺陷表面与正常表面的差异对镀铜表面进行检测。实验结果表明,该算法能精确的检测出各类缺陷所在位置及其面积大小且速度较快,达到了在线检测的要求。

An algorithm of detecting surface defects of copper plating based on dynamic threshold

Abstract:Detection of the surface defection based on computer vision is a main problem in detection field. Aiming at characteristic of surface defects of copper plating, a dynamic threshold method for the trait of defection in the surface of copper plating is put forward. In the algorithm, surface defects are detected through combining the gray feature of the whole and local using the difference between natural and defective surface. Experimental results show that the proposed algorithm can detect the position and area of defection effectively and meet the requirements of online detecting.
